Each member of any board, committee or commission of the City <br /> <br />shall be required to vote on matters coming before that body unless such member shall have <br /> <br />a conflict of interest concerning the matter to be voted on. <br /> <br />Subd. 3 Minimum Requirement for Action. Unless otherwise specifically provided, a <br /> <br />majority of the members of any board, committee or commission present and voting at any <br /> <br />meeting thereof shall be required for any action or decision of such board, committee or <br /> <br />commission. <br /> <br />220,02 Advisory Committees. Advisory commlttees may be established by the Council as may <br /> <br />be needed from time to time for the efficient operation and administration of the affairs of the <br /> <br />City.
